Oh Sorry just realized I didn't explain what I meant by ABCXYZ 🙂

 

So ABC is a basic pareto: A = 80% of Value sold, B = 15% of Value and C=5% of Value Sold

XYZ is the measure of the variability using the Coefficient of variation (CoV) with CoV = Divide(Standard Deviation, Average Sales) (Deviation and Average measured on a monthly basis)

I can do the dymamic segmentation separately using the DAX patter, no problem, but I want to be able to present the data in a matrix ABC/XYZ, so I would need to combine the both calculation together, and I am strggling with that.
